    Decide How Many Employees

    You know that your labor rate will be the largest factor in determining your lawn care prices, so your focus should also be on what influences your labor rate. In this case, that would be your employees.

    And since you wouldnt be able to grow as quickly without your employees, pricing their labor takes skill.

    When you assess a job for a potential client, determine how many workers it will take to complete the job in a reasonable amount of time.

    To get your total labor rate, add each employees hourly rate to get your total hourly labor rate. Then multiply that by the number of hours the job will take to complete.

    For example, lets say a job takes two hours for two of your employees to complete, and you pay each of them $40 an hour.

    $40 x 2 employees = $80 hourly rate$80 x 2 hours = $160 total price of the job

    Remember, $160 does not include factors such as special services, a markup for profit, or overhead as labor costs are only one part of the lawn mowing pricing formula needed to create estimates.

    How Often Do You Want To Have Your Lawn Mowed

    There are some instances in which a homeowner only wants to have their lawn mowed every once in a while. They might call on a lawn care service to cut their lawn when theyre away on vacation or when theyve had a long week at work and dont have time to mow.

    When this is the case, most lawn care services will extend one price to their customers. But when customers agree to have their lawn mowed by a service on a regular basis throughout the spring and summer seasons, theyll often get access to a differentsee: lowerprice.

    Lawn care services are open to charging their regular customers less than their one-time customers to show their appreciation to them. Theyre also able to get into a routine when cutting these lawns so that they take them less time overall.

    You might be able to score a great deal on grass cutting services by scheduling regular mows as opposed to only scheduling them every so often.

    Are There Any Obstacles That Could Make It Hard To Mow Your Lawn

    Do you have a relatively flat lawn that doesnt have many trees and bushes on it? Its going to be pretty easy for a lawn mowing service to knock your lawn out without charging you an arm and a leg for it.

    But if you have a lawn that has hills or if you have a lawn with tons of trees and other obstacles, it can present problems for a lawn mowing service. Theyll have to take their time when mowing your lawn, and youll end up paying the price for it.

    You obviously cant do a whole lot about any obstacles situated throughout your lawn. But you can make sure youre aware of them and the role that they might play in the price you pay for lawn mowing.

    Does Your Company Use A Gas Mower

    Fluctuating gas prices will have an affect on the cost of your lawn mowing and trimming services if your service provider uses a gas mower. Some companies will reflect those prices in their cost per service each time, while other companies may update their pricing yearly. For example, a company may increase prices by $5-$10 after a year if gas prices have continued to climb, but they won’t change their prices on a week-by-week basis.

    Some companies use only electrical mowers and trimmers, so fluctuations in gas prices don’t affect them. Their equipment runs from pre-charged batteries or through extension cords plugged into your electrical outlets.

    What’s Included In Lawn Maintenance Vs Lawn Care Service

    While the wording may vary from company to company, lawn maintenance typically includes all the services that keep your current healthy lawn looking sharp. Think mowing, watering, weeding, and a spring or fall cleanup.

    Lawn care digs a bit deeper. These packages may include services that elevate your lawn’s health or address an issue throughout the year. Fertilization, pest and weed control, and dethatching all fall into this category.

    Lawn Care Service Prices

    Lawn care professionals provide many different service outside of just mowing. Depending on where you live, and how long its been since your yard has been maintained, some additional services may be needed. Let’s take a look at some common lawn services and their prices:

    • Lawn Mowing: Average cost $25 – $50
    • Tree Trimming: Average cost $250 – $500
    • Lawn Aeration: Average cost $80 – $175
    • Lawn Weeding: Average cost $20 – $40 /hour
    • Lawn Winterization: Average cost $350
    • Lawn Fertilizing: Average cost $40 – $60 /application
    • Lawn Seeding: Average cost for professional $700
    • Leaf Removal: Average cost $50 – $80
    • Landscaping: Average cost between $3,000 and $15,950

    How To Quote A Lawn Mowing Job

    How to Collect Money from Lawn Care Customers

    Quoting a lawn mowing job requires you to strike a balance between earning profits and giving a fair price to the client.

    When quoting a lawn mowing job, you can use one of these three approaches:

    • Time-based rate: Most new lawn care professionals charge by the hour because its a straightforward and transparent way to price jobs. With this pricing method, you can also factor in equipment setup and cleanup in your hourly rates, earning you an extra bit of cash before and after work.
    • Square footage rate: Pricing your job by how many square feet youre mowing is a fair pricing method for businesses. However, this approach doesnt factor in whether a clients lawn has hilly terrain or trees, which can throw off your calculations and extend job hours.
    • Flat rate: The simplest pricing model is to charge a flat rate regardless of the time you take to complete the job. This is best used for recurring clients.

    Keep in mind that not all yards are large enough for you to turn a profit. So you dont lose money working on especially small lawns, consider setting a minimum rate or price.
